... stabilization,so can keep your sensation of movement in development,make your exercise more enjoyable.- Bioacceleration TechnologyQuicken ... circulation and reduce sludging of blood&body fluid in terminal to prevent edema,At the same time, ... Road, Huangcun Town, Daxing District, Beijing, China. Established in 2004, our company integrates design, production and sales together. We ...